Latin Arguet tē malitia tua, et āversiō tua increpābit tē. Scītō et vidē quia malum et amārum est relīquisse tē Dominum Deum tuum, et nōn esse timōrem meī apud tē, dīcit Dominus Deus exercituum.

Jeremias 1:18

English Thy own wickedness shall reprove thee, and thy apostasy shall rebuke thee. Know thou, and see that it is an evil and a bitter thing for thee, to have left the Lord thy God, and that my fear is not with thee, saith the Lord the God of hosts.
